Overview:

Shimmick Construction is looking to hire an experienced Office Assistant/Purchasing Assistant to support our project in Lake Elsinore, CA. This challenging position will provide an excellent growth opportunity while helping to improve our infrastructure.

Shimmick has a long history of completing complex water projects, ranging from the worlds largest wastewater recycling and purification system in California to the record-setting Hoover Dam. In 2021, we began a transformation to re-envision our strategy to meet the nations growing need for water and other critical infrastructure.

Today, Shimmick is at the forefront of delivering solutions to meet the nations growing demand for water infrastructure.

Our commitment extends to water treatment, water conveyance, water storage, flood protection, environmental projects, and more. Our solid foundation of enduring client relationships, financial stability, market leadership, effective risk management, and strategic presence in key regions ensures our ability to execute this crucial mission.

Southwest Division

Shimmicks Southwest Division, headquartered in Irvine, California, focuses on large public owners in Southern California, across water resources, water treatment, transportation and transit markets. Over the past decade, the division has grown tremendously, securing major projects, including the $350 million North City Pure Water Facility in San Diego at the $200 million Groundwater Replenishment System in Orange County.

Responsibilities:

The responsibilities of this position include, but are not limited to the following:

  • Processing, coordination, and management of Union Payroll for project
  • Prepare, analyze, and transmit Certified Payroll and any/all additional reporting documents per project and contract specifications
  • Document Control for project through CMiC software
  • Provide support in accounting and project management modules in CMiC
  • Invoicing; pay applications; waivers
  • Coordination with subcontractors
    • Management of project insurance requirements with subcontractors and vendors
  • Process New Hires (Craft and Salaried) Paperwork, training videos, drug testing
  • Coordinate and manage month end close with corporate office in order to provide timely and accurate reporting for project
  • Manage project office facilities
    • Stock and inventory control for office and products
  • Coordinate Verizon and Sprint cell/radio use for project
  • Ensure the housekeeping of the office by maintaining the appearance of common areas
    • Stock and inventory control for office and products
    • Sanitize bid room, kitchen, phones, doorknobs, all other common areas daily
  • Oversee the day-to-day activities of the office as the main point of contact in the reception area
    • Order and set up catered lunch (when applicable)
    • Check mailbox daily and distribute mail
    • Receiving all incoming phone calls
  • Provide administrative support as needed, including scheduling meetings and events, booking travel, mailing, and shipping packages
